Pitzer College Alumnus Wins Southern California Horticultural Society Grant

Claremont, Calif. (May 20, 2009) — Pitzer College congratulates John Lee ’09, recipient of an educational internship grant from the Southern California Horticultural Society.

Lee, who double majored in environmental studies and economics, will use the grant this summer on the Pitzer campus to gain knowledge and experience in landscaping and gardening with an emphasis on sustainability and environmental consciousness.

The Southern California Horticultural Society is a nonprofit educational organization dedicated to encouraging interests in horticulture in Southern California. The organization sponsors training internships at local botanic gardens each year.

Lee hopes to work in ecological restoration or organic agriculture with a specific focus in sustainable development. He also plans to attend graduate school to study environmental policy and/or natural resource management.
